Benton is a borough located in Columbia County, Pennsylvania. Benton has a 2025 population of 821. Benton is currently declining at a rate of 0% annually and its population has decreased by -0.24% since the most recent census, which recorded a population of 823 in 2020.
The average household income in Benton is $44,946 with a poverty rate of 25.91%.The median age in Benton is 45.5 years: 31.7 years for males, and 52.6 years for females.

The racial composition of Benton includes 93.93% White, 3.24% Asian, and smaller percentages for Two or more races and multiracial populations.
Race | Population | Percentage (of total) |
---|---|---|
White | 464 | 93.93% |
Asian | 16 | 3.24% |
Two or more races | 14 | 2.83% |

Benton's average per capita income is $32,500. Household income levels show a median of $36,429. The poverty rate stands at 25.91%.
Name | Median | Mean |
---|---|---|
Married Families | $75,500 | - |
Families | $52,000 | $64,846 |
Households | $36,429 | $44,946 |
Non Families | $18,750 | $28,945 |
